This week I experienced the honor of being sworn in as a U.S. citizen. This may feel like somewhat of a personal blog; however, each year the USCIS welcomes an average 700,000 new citizens and, as our ceremony’s guest speaker emphasized, part of becoming a citizen is sharing your story. Growing up, I didn’t necessarily know U.S. citizenship would be part of my story, but I’m proud it is!
Each case is unique; in mine, the process was smooth and, most importantly, fast! There were only seven months between the moment I submitted my application and the swear-in ceremony — it could typically take 18 to 20 months for a case to be completed.
I want to attribute my lack of nerves and failure to recognize how much this meant to how busy I kept myself and the fact I have been living here for eight years, paying taxes like every other American, so I already felt like a true American citizen.
Quite a few of my family members are naturalized citizens, and they paved the way to get me here. It wasn’t until I saw the other 66 applicants and their family members that I understood the magnitude of this accomplishment.
Sixty-seven strangers.
Thirty-five countries.
A common goal.
All of the people in that room have a story of hard work, dedication and sacrifice. Once we were asked to stand and raise our right hand to say the Oath of Allegiance, my eyes watered, my throat closed up, and it was as if I was reliving the decade I spent as a resident and all of the years my mother sacrificed our time together to build a better future for me. That was THAT moment, the one where I saw all those sacrifices pay off.
To me, being an American means I now belong to a country formed to bring people together. And now my voice holds the power to help my fellow citizens continue to make that happen.
— Yasser Ogando, production & advertising coordinator
